This creates the low-frequency portion of the band-stop … WebMar 24, 2024 · Filter cutoff frequencies are typically set to the -3 decibel (dB), or half power point. This is the frequency where the filtered signal amplitude falls to 0.707 of the amplitude at DC. If the acquisition system design requires a flatter frequency response, the cutoff might be defined with a lower attenuation value—for instance, -1 dB.

In signal processing, a band-stop filter or band-rejection filter is a filter that passes most frequencies unaltered, but attenuates those in a specific range to very low levels. It is the opposite of a band-pass filter. A notch filter is a band-stop filter with a narrow stopband (high Q factor).
